AFCON CAMEROON 2021 Senegal v Malawi: Confirmed Line-Ups

Senegal meet Malawi on Tuesday evening with both teams determined to sneak through to the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ON) knockout stage in Cameroon.

Senegal share Group B top spot with Guinea on four points from two games each and a win for the Teranga Lions would see them through to the next stage.

The Teranga Lions started the group’s campaign with a slender 1-0 win over bottom-placed Zimbabwe, thanks to Sadio Mane’s injury time penalty earned after the Warriors defender’s handball.

Against, Malawi, Senegal need to up their game especially upfront where they have not been at their fluent best despite possessing an array of stars, including the Liverpool forward.

Chelsea goalkeeper Eduardo Mendy, fresh from winning Fifa best keeper award, might be back in goals for Senegal to replace Dieng alongside captain Kalidou Koulibaly in defence.

Both players missed the two games for Senegal after testing positive for Covid-19.

Malawi have plenty at stake going into the game as the players have been promised free trays of eggs for a year and pieces of land at a discount plus $1,200 each if they beat Senegal.

Two firms have made the pledges for the eggs and land whereas Malawi president Lazarus Chakwera has made the cash pledge.

The Flames lost 1-0 to Guinea in the opening match before bouncing back to beat Zimbabwe 2-1 on Friday, thanks to Gabadinho Mhango’s brace.

Coach Mario Marinica, who missed the two games due to Covid, will return to the bench to join stand-in mentor Meck Mwase who held fort.

Marinica has since named uncapped goalkeeper Charles Thom in the starting XI in the absence of Ernest Kakhobwe who is unavailable.

The coach has also restored midfielder Micium Mhone to the starting squad and dropped striker Richard Mbulu.

Malawi can only be certain of qualification if they will while a draw might not offer a straight forward option.

In another game for the group, Guinea take on eliminated Zimbabwe in another match for the group.

Head -to-Head

Malawi and Senegal have meet thrice in all competitions with the Flames winning once and twice for the Teranga Lions.

The two teams last met on July 14 the Cosafa Cup held in South Africa where the Flames lost 2-1.

Current Form

Senegal have won twice and drawn once in the last three games across all competitions whereas Malawi have won twice and lost twice in the last four games including friendlies.

Rankings

Malawi are ranked on a distant 129th place on Fifa rankings compared to 20th position for Senegal who are also Africa’s top rated side.

Line-Ups:

Senegal: Eduardo Mendy, Saliou Ciss, Kalidou Koulibaly, Idrissa Gueye, Nampalys Mendy, Cheikhou Kouyate, Boulaye Dia, Mouhamadou Diallo, Bouna Sarr, Abdou Diallo, Sadio Mane

Malawi: Charles Thom, Stanley Sanudi, Chembezi Dennis, Lawrence Chaziya, Gomezgani Chirwa, John Banda, Fransisco Madinga, Chimwemwe Idana, Micium Mhone, Gabadinho Mhango, Khuda Muyaba
